Future Funds definition

Future Funds mean any account or private pooled investment vehicle, in each case focused on investing in securities, with a general partner of which the Partnership or its Affiliates will have an ownership interest; provided however, no private or public entity created for the purposes of directly owning hotel assets or incubating future REITs will be considered a “Future Fund”.
Future Funds means any investment vehicle with the same Investment Restrictions as the Fund; “GAAP” means generally accepted accounting principles;
Future Funds means such other investment entities as may be formed in the future as to which the Manager and/or its Affiliates may act directly or indirectly as sponsors and/or investment advisors.
